Date: Friday, April 9, 2010 @ 02:18:41 Author: dgriffiths Revision: 76928
Cleanup, adopted Modified: docbook-xsl/trunk/PKGBUILD ----------+ PKGBUILD | 44 +++++++++++++++++++++++++------------------- 1 file changed, 25 insertions(+), 19 deletions(-) Modified: PKGBUILD =================================================================== --- PKGBUILD 2010-04-09 06:18:06 UTC (rev 76927) +++ PKGBUILD 2010-04-09 06:18:41 UTC (rev 76928) @@ -1,37 +1,43 @@ # $Id$ -# Maintainer: Jan de Groot <j...@archlinux.org> +# Contributer: Jan de Groot <j...@archlinux.org> # Contributer: Sean Middleditch <elant...@awesomeplay.com> +# Maintainer: Daniel J Griffiths <ghost1...@archlinux.us> pkgname=docbook-xsl pkgver=1.75.2 pkgrel=1 -pkgdesc="XML stylesheets for Docbook-xml transformations." +pkgdesc='XML stylesheets for Docbook-xml transformations.' arch=('any') license=('custom') -url="http://scrollkeeper.sourceforge.net/docbook.shtml" +url='http://scrollkeeper.sourceforge.net/docbook.shtml' depends=('libxml2' 'libxslt' 'docbook-xml') source=(http://downloads.sourceforge.net/sourceforge/docbook/docbook-xsl-${pkgver}.tar.bz2) install=docbook-xsl.install md5sums=('0c76a58a8e6cb5ab49f819e79917308f') build() { - cd ${srcdir}/${pkgname}-${pkgver} - install -dm755 ${pkgdir}/usr/share/xml/docbook/xsl-stylesheets-${pkgver}/common - install -m644 common/*.{xml,xsl,dtd,ent} ${pkgdir}/usr/share/xml/docbook/xsl-stylesheets-${pkgver}/common/ + /bin/true +} - install -dm755 ${pkgdir}/usr/share/xml/docbook/xsl-stylesheets-${pkgver}/params - install -m644 params/*.xml ${pkgdir}/usr/share/xml/docbook/xsl-stylesheets-${pkgver}/params/ +package() { + pkgroot=${pkgdir}/usr/share/xml/docbook/xsl-stylesheets-${pkgver} - for fn in fo highlighting html roundtrip; do - install -dm755 ${pkgdir}/usr/share/xml/docbook/xsl-stylesheets-${pkgver}/${fn} - install -m644 ${fn}/*.{xml,xsl} ${pkgdir}/usr/share/xml/docbook/xsl-stylesheets-${pkgver}/${fn}/ - done - for fn in eclipse htmlhelp javahelp lib manpages profiling template website xhtml; do - install -dm755 ${pkgdir}/usr/share/xml/docbook/xsl-stylesheets-${pkgver}/${fn} - install -m644 ${fn}/*.xsl ${pkgdir}/usr/share/xml/docbook/xsl-stylesheets-${pkgver}/${fn}/ - done - install -dm755 ${pkgdir}/etc/xml - install -m644 VERSION ${pkgdir}/usr/share/xml/docbook/xsl-stylesheets-${pkgver}/ + cd ${srcdir}/${pkgname}-${pkgver} + install -dm755 ${pkgroot}/{common,params} + install -m644 common/*.{xml,xsl,dtd,ent} ${pkgroot}/common/ + install -m644 params/*.xml ${pkgroot}/params/ - install -m644 -D COPYING ${pkgdir}/usr/share/licenses/${pkgname}/COPYING + for fn in fo highlighting html roundtrip; do + install -dm755 ${pkgroot}/${fn} + install -m644 ${fn}/*.{xml,xsl} ${pkgroot}/${fn}/ + done + + for fn in eclipse htmlhelp javahelp lib manpages profiling template website xhtml; do + install -dm755 ${pkgroot}/${fn} + install -m644 ${fn}/*.xsl ${pkgroot}/${fn}/ + done + + install -dm755 ${pkgdir}/etc/xml + install -m644 VERSION ${pkgroot}/ + install -Dm644 COPYING ${pkgdir}/usr/share/licenses/${pkgname}/COPYING }